简介
solaris-model
是一个用于构建 Solaris 系统关系型数据库 Schema 的 Node.js 模块。它允许用户通过编写简单的 JavaScript 版本的 Schema,自动生成数据库表结构。
使用 solaris-model
可以简化数据库 Schema 设计和维护的过程,使代码更具可读性和可维护性。
安装
可以通过 npm
命令进行安装:
npm install solaris-model
安装完成后,就可以在项目中使用 solaris-model
了。
快速开始
在使用 solaris-model
之前,需要先配置好数据库连接信息。可以在项目中创建一个 db.js
文件,用于存储数据库连接信息,例如:
module.exports = { host: 'localhost', port: 3306, user: 'root', password: 'password', database: 'solaris' };
在项目中创建一个 User.js
文件,定义一个 User
数据模型:
-- -------------------- ---- ------- ----- - ----- - - ------------------------- ----- -- - ---------------- ----- ---- ------- ----- - ------ --------- - -------- ------ -- - --- ------ ---------- - - --- - ----- ---------- ----------- ----- -------------- ---- -- ----- - ----- --------- --------- ---- -- ---- - ----- ---------- --------- ---- -- ------ - ----- --------- ------- ---- - - - -------------- - -----
在 User.js
中,我们继承了 Model
类,并定义了数据库表名和数据库连接信息。在 attributes
中定义了数据表结构。
id: { type: 'integer', primaryKey: true, autoIncrement: true },
这段代码定义了 id
字段是一个整型,为主键,并且自动增长。
name: { type: 'string', required: true },
这段代码定义了 name
字段是一个字符串类型,并且是必需的。其他字段同理。
接下来,在项目中可以使用 User
数据模型进行数据操作:
-- -------------------- ---- ------- ----- ---- - ------------------ -- ------ ----- ---- - --- ------ ----- -------- ---- --- ------ ------------------- --- ------------ -- ---- ----- ----- - ----- --------------- ------------------- -- ---- --------- - ------ ------------ -- ---- ---------------
总结
在本文中,我们介绍了如何使用 solaris-model
模块来构建 Solaris 系统关系型数据库 Schema。我们从安装和快速开始讲起,详细介绍了 solaris-model
的使用方法,并提供了示例代码。希望本文对你有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055d3981e8991b448dafec